Gujarati[edit]
Etymology[edit]
Inherited from Prakrit 𑀈𑀲𑀸 (īsā), from Sanskrit ईषा (īṣā́), from Proto-Indo-Aryan *HiHsáH, from Proto-Indo-Iranian *HiHsáH, from Proto-Indo-European *h₂iHséh₂ (“shaft”). Cognate with Assamese ঈহ (ih).
Pronunciation[edit]
- (Standard Gujarati) IPA(key): /ˈis/
- Rhymes: -is
- Hyphenation: ઈસ
Noun[edit]
ઈસ • (īsa) f
- side piece of a cot
